      Originally posted by 1tuff4b View Post
      Exmouth for a week after that (anyone recommend a good fishing charter??).
      I was up there in 2011 and booked with a company called On Strike fishing charters. At the time the captain was due to get a new boat but after a few delays on the boat it wasn't there in time, so at the last minute he had to flick us (me and two mates) over to another charter called Peak Sportfishing.

      We had a great time and caught a couple of mackies whilst trolling and then spent a lot of the day cruising around the islands, getting a few snapper and trevally.

      Both On Strike and Peak have websites.

      Cost was $300 per head.
